titleOfInvention Hydrogen production catalyst
abstract P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a hydrogen production reaction catalyst by a partial oxidation reaction of hydrocarbons having both high activity for partial oxidation reaction and high heat resistance / durability. The following general formula (1) La 2 (Ce 2−x M x ) O 7 (1) (Wherein M is Nb or Ta and x is 0 ≦ x ≦ 2), and a partial oxidation reaction of hydrocarbon gas using a hydrogen generation catalyst comprising a composite oxide having a pyrochlore structure To produce hydrogen fuel. X in the formula (1) is preferably 0 ≦ x ≦ 0.5, and more preferably 0.05 ≦ x ≦ 0.3. [Selection] Figure 3
